After getting a good night's rest, your body needs to refuel and to ensure productivity throughout the day, your first meal of the day should be healthy, balanced, and nutritious. A strong cup of coffee with a slice of toast alone for breakfast is not the best solution. It is important to add ingredients that burn energy slowly like whole grains, fibre and proteins to keep you full for a longer time and a little bit of unsaturated fat. Completely avoidable are bad carbs that are full of sugar which can give you extreme highs and lows and saturated fat which builds up cholesterol.
So, along with your regular tea and coffee, try whipping up one of these easy breakfasts for a healthy morning routine that will give you the much necessary energy boost.
Oats - Packed with filling fibre this is the best diet for a staple breakfast. You can sweeten it with your choice of fruits and honey while for a spicy version make oats with salt and spices.
Smoothies - A quick-to-make breakfast option, smoothies made by blending chunks of fruits or green, leafy vegetables along with water or yoghurt is quite filling too.
Whole-grain cereals - Choose from whole-grain or bran cereals which have fibre along with essential nutrients like iron and protein. Mix in with skimmed milk with as little or no sugar added.
Toast with tomatoes - Toasted whole-grain bread topped with tomato slices, sprinkled with herbs like basil, thyme and pepper makes for a tasty breakfast treat.
Curds with fruits and nuts - If you can have curds in the morning, take a bowl of your favourite chopped fruits, add nuts and curds to it. Drizzle honey and add some mint for a refreshing salad.
Eggs - Remember the best time to eat eggs is for morning breakfast, so whip up an omelette with vegetables, fry your eggs or have them boiled, they are one protein-packed and heart-healthy food.
